Accounting Business Analyst Nicosia, Cyprus

Accounting Business Analyst Description

We are looking for an experienced Business Analyst knowledgeable in Bookkeeping/Accounting for our office in Cyprus to help our client (provider of pension and financial solutions) with migrating financial data from external vendor to new internal accounting software.

Our client is modernizing their Real Estate Asset Portfolio Management and decided to integrate a new Fund- and SPV-Accounting system based on an off the shelf product. To move forward with the implementation this software needs to be properly configured, populated with data and tested.

Responsibilities

  • Elicit, analyze and manage requirements from stakeholders
  • Communicate and facilitate discussions with stakeholders (Product Owners, Business Analysts from different countries)
  • Possess and manage the Product Backlog by defining, prioritizing and refining tasks
  • Possess a deep understanding of the product structure, business processes and data model
  • Conduct Product Backlog Refinement/Grooming sessions to clarify and update requirements, decompose tasks and formulate acceptance criteria
  • Assist the development team in interpreting and clarifying requirements, decomposing tasks and formulating acceptance criteria
  • Build and maintain the project documentation
  • Help the QA team with manual and acceptance testing

Requirements

  • Minimum of 5 years of experience as a Business Analyst
  • Strong understanding of accounting principles, financial processes and reporting requirements according to IFRS/GAAP
  • ACCA/CFA certificate or equivalent is strongly preferred
  • Previous experience in accounting system configuration projects is strongly preferred
  • Proficiency in working with specifications, writing user stories and acceptance criteria, as well as experience in conducting requirements elicitation, analysis and management
  • Understanding of requirements lifecycle and requirements quality criteria
  • Experience in business process and data modelling
  • Ability to build, compose and structure the project documentation
  • Understanding the software development lifecycle
  • Technical background with an understanding of microservice architecture, RESTful APIs and database design
  • Excellent communication and analytical skills
  • Fluency in English
